Irrigation well installation services involve setting up a dedicated water source beneath the ground to supply a landscape watering system. This process typically includes drilling or digging to access underground water supplies, installing a well casing, and connecting it to a network of pipes and sprinklers. These systems are designed to provide a reliable and consistent water source, reducing dependence on municipal water supplies and ensuring that lawns, gardens, and landscaping receive adequate hydration throughout the growing season.

This service helps address common problems such as inconsistent watering, high water bills, and restrictions on outdoor water use during dry periods. For properties with large lawns, extensive gardens, or commercial landscapes, relying solely on city water can be inefficient and costly. An irrigation well offers a sustainable solution, especially in areas where municipal water pressure is limited or where drought restrictions are frequent. Additionally, well systems can help maintain the health and appearance of outdoor spaces by providing a steady water supply, even during periods of water conservation.

Properties that typically benefit from irrigation well installation include rural homes, properties with large or irregularly shaped lawns, and commercial or agricultural sites. Homes situated outside city limits often depend on wells for their water needs, making well installation essential for efficient landscape watering. Larger properties with extensive landscaping or outdoor features like sports fields or orchards may also find well systems advantageous. Even some suburban properties with high water usage can improve their irrigation efficiency and reduce costs by installing a dedicated well system.

The overview below groups typical Irrigation Well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Doylestown, PA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or irrigation well repairs or maintenance in Doylestown range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and well condition.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.

Standard Well Installation - Installing a new irrigation well usually costs between $3,000 and $7,000. Most projects in the area land in this range, covering moderate-depth wells and standard setups, while larger or more complex installations can go higher.

Full Well Replacement - Replacing an existing irrigation well with a new one typically costs between $4,500 and $10,000. Many homeowners experience costs in this range, though very deep or specialized wells may push prices beyond that.

Large or Custom Projects - Extensive irrigation well systems or custom installations can reach $12,000 or more. These projects are less common and usually involve complex site conditions, requiring specialized equipment and longer installation times.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ing an irrigation well? An irrigation well can provide a reliable water source for maintaining lawns and gardens, especially in areas with limited municipal water access.

How do local contractors determine the best well size for my property? Contractors assess your landscape, water needs, and soil conditions to recommend an appropriate well size that ensures adequate irrigation coverage.

Is it necessary to obtain permits for irrigation well installation? Permit requirements vary by location; local service providers can advise on the necessary approvals and assist with the application process if needed.

What types of pumps are typically used in irrigation well systems? Common pumps include jet pumps and submersible pumps, selected based on well depth and water demand to ensure efficient operation.

How long does it usually take to install an irrigation well? Installation times depend on site conditions and system complexity, with local contractors providing estimates based on the specific project requirements.
